Neueste Web-Entwicklung Tutorials
 

ADO GetRows Method


<Komplett - Cord - Object Reference

Die GetRows Methode kopiert mehrere Datensätze von einem Cord-Objekt in ein zweidimensionales Array.

Syntax

vararray=objRecordset.GetRows(rows,start,fields)

Parameter Beschreibung
rows Optional. Ein GetRowsOptionEnum Wert, der die Anzahl der Datensätze abzurufen angibt. Die Standardeinstellung ist adGetRowsRest.

Note: Wenn Sie dieses Argument nicht angegeben wird es alle Datensätze in dem Re- Cord abrufen

start

Optional. Welche Aufzeichnung starten auf, eine Rekordzahl oder einen BookmarkEnum Wert

fields Optional. Wenn Sie nur die Felder angeben möchten, dass die GetRows zurückkehren nennen, ist es möglich, ein einzelnes Feld Name / Nummer oder ein Array von Feldnamen / Zahlen in diesem Argument übergeben

Beispiel

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open(Server.Mappath("northwind.mdb"))
set rs = Server.CreateObject("ADODB.recordset")
rs.Open "Select * from Customers", conn

'The first number indicates how many records to copy
'The second number indicates what recordnumber to start on
p=rs.GetRows(2,0)
rs.close
conn.close

'This example returns the value of the first
'column in the first two records
response.write(p(0,0))
response.write("<br>")
response.write(p(0,1))

'This example returns the value of the first
'three columns in the first record
response.write(p(0,0))
response.write("<br>")
response.write(p(1,0))
response.write("<br>")
response.write(p(2,0))
%>

GetRowsOptionEnum Werte

Konstante Wert Beschreibung
adGetRowsRest-1 Ruft den Rest der Datensätze in dem Re-Cord-Objekt

BookmarkEnum Werte

Konstante Wert Beschreibung
adBookmarkCurrent0 Beginnt am aktuellen Datensatz
adBookmarkFirst1 Beginnt am ersten Datensatz
adBookmarkLast2 Beginnt am letzten Datensatz

<Komplett - Cord - Object Reference